Background
Fracturing and acidizing of an oil-water well are technical measures for mainly increasing production and injection of an oil field, and a large amount of returned water generated by the measures needs to be reused after innocent treatment. When oily sewage is treated, oil stains in the sewage need to be treated. In the prior art, when the prior oily sewage pretreatment device is used for removing oily sewage in sewage, the removal effect of the oily sewage in the sewage is poor, so that a large amount of oily sewage can be remained in the sewage after sewage treatment.
The utility model provides a high concentration oily sewage pretreatment device that patent document discloses that has been granted for such as application number CN202020902772.5, includes the main part, the main part is cylindrical tubular structure, the one end fixedly connected with connecting plate of main part, the connecting plate is kept away from one side fixedly connected with motor of main part, the output shaft of motor is located the axle center department of main part, just the output shaft of motor runs through the lateral wall fixedly connected with pivot of connecting plate, the surface of pivot is equipped with helical blade, the main part is close to the one end lower surface of motor runs through and is equipped with the delivery port. Compared with the treatment device in the prior art, the high-concentration oily sewage pretreatment device is characterized in that cooling water is introduced into the water inlet pipe, so that the cooling water enters the rotating shaft, and flows out of the water outlet pipe after the rotating shaft is filled, so that the rotating shaft is cooled, and oily sewage flowing through the inside of the main body is condensed at low temperature and is adhered to the surfaces of the rotating shaft and the spiral fan blades, and is adhered to the side wall of the main body under the action of centrifugal force.
The above patent has a problem that the removal effect of the oil stain in the sewage is poor, for example, the oil stain condensed and adhered on the rotating shaft and the spiral fan blade is not adhered on the side wall of the main body under the action of centrifugal force under the high-speed rotation of the rotating shaft and the spiral fan blade, but is discharged along with the sewage, so that the removal effect of the oil stain in the sewage is poor, and therefore, we need to propose an oily sewage pretreatment device.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1-5, the present utility model provides a technical solution: the utility model provides an oily sewage pretreatment device, including oil removal tank 1, oil removal tank 1's lateral part fixed mounting has mounting bracket 2, oil removal tank 1's top fixedly connected with fixed plate 3, be provided with adjustment mechanism on mounting bracket 2 and the fixed plate 3, fixed mounting has first electric putter 9 on the adjustment mechanism, fixed mounting has deoiling board 10 on the telescopic link of first electric putter 9, cavity 19 has been seted up in the deoiling board 10, the top intercommunication of deoiling board 10 has inlet tube 11 and outlet pipe 15, the intercommunication has first three-way pipe 12 and second three-way pipe 16 respectively on inlet tube 11 and the outlet pipe 15, two import of first three-way pipe 12 communicate respectively has cold water inlet tube 13 and hot water inlet tube 14, two import of second three-way pipe 16 communicate respectively has cold water outlet pipe 17 and hot water outlet pipe 18;
the adjusting mechanism comprises a driving motor 4, a screw rod 5 and a mounting plate 7, wherein the driving motor 4 is fixedly arranged on the side part of the mounting frame 2, the driving motor 4 is fixedly connected with the screw rod 5 through a coupler, the screw rod 5 is rotatably arranged in the fixed plate 3, the mounting plate 7 is arranged on the screw rod 5 in a threaded manner, a fixing frame 8 is fixedly arranged at the bottom of the mounting plate 7, a first electric push rod 9 is fixedly arranged on the fixing frame 8, the mounting frame 2 and the fixed plate 3 are fixedly connected with a positioning rod 6, and the mounting plate 7 is movably arranged on the positioning rod 6;
through the arrangement of the positioning rod 6, the screw rod 5 can be driven to rotate by the rotation of the output shaft of the driving motor 4, when the screw rod 5 drives the mounting plate 7 to move, the mounting plate 7 can be positioned through the positioning rod 6, the mounting plate 7 can move stably, and the cold water inlet pipe 13, the hot water inlet pipe 14, the cold water outlet pipe 17 and the hot water outlet pipe 18 are all arranged as hoses, so that the cold water inlet pipe 13, the hot water inlet pipe 14, the cold water outlet pipe 17 and the hot water outlet pipe 18 can move along with the mounting plate 7 when the mounting plate 7 moves;
the scraper mechanism is arranged on the mounting frame 2 and comprises a second electric push rod 22 and a scraper 23, the second electric push rod 22 is fixedly arranged at the bottom of the mounting frame 2, the scraper 23 is fixedly arranged on a telescopic rod of the second electric push rod 22, a first collecting box 20 and a second collecting box 21 are arranged at the top of the mounting frame 2, and the first collecting box 20 and the second collecting box 21 are respectively arranged at two sides of the scraper 23;
the side part of the oil removing tank 1 is communicated with a drain pipe 24, a drain valve 25 is arranged on the drain pipe 24, the side part of the oil removing tank 1 is communicated with a sewage inlet pipe 26, the oil removing plate 10 is arranged in the oil removing tank 1, and the oil removing plate 10 is attached to the inner wall of the oil removing tank 1;
in the specific use process, firstly, after sewage is discharged into the oil removal tank 1 through the sewage inlet pipe 26, the first electric push rod 9 works, the oil removal plate 10 is pushed by the telescopic rod of the first electric push rod 9, so that the oil removal plate 10 is contacted with the liquid level of the sewage, hot water can be injected into the cavity 19 of the oil removal plate 10 through the hot water inlet pipe 14, the first three-way pipe 12 and the water inlet pipe 11, the oil removal plate 10 can be heated, the heated oil removal plate 10 can melt the oil dirt floating and agglomerating on the sewage, the oil dirt can float on the sewage after being separated from sundries, and the water of the oil removal plate 10 can be discharged through the water outlet pipe 15, the second three-way pipe 16 and the hot water outlet pipe 18;
the cold water inlet pipe 13, the first three-way pipe 12 and the water inlet pipe 11 can be used for injecting ice water into the cavity 19 of the oil removal plate 10, the injected ice water can be used for cooling the oil removal plate 10, when the oil stain floating on the sewage contacts with the oil removal plate 10, the oil stain floating on the sewage can be condensed and attached to the oil removal plate 10 at low temperature, the oil stain floating on the sewage can be removed, and the water cooled by the oil removal plate 10 can be discharged through the water outlet pipe 15, the second three-way pipe 16 and the cold water outlet pipe 17;
after the oil removal plate 10 removes oil stains, the telescopic rod of the first electric push rod 9 retracts to drive the oil removal plate 10 to return to the original position, the driving motor 4 works, the output shaft of the driving motor 4 rotates to drive the screw rod 5 to rotate, the positioning rod 6 is matched with the mounting plate 7 to drive the oil removal plate 10 to move when the screw rod 5 rotates, when the oil removal plate 10 moves, the second electric push rod 22 works, the telescopic rod of the second electric push rod 22 pushes the scraping plate 23 to enable the scraping plate 23 to move upwards, the oil stains attached to the bottom of the oil removal plate 10 can be scraped through the scraping plate 23, the scraped oil stains can fall into the first collecting box 20 to be collected, and when the oil removal plate 10 is driven to return to the original position by the driving motor 4 matched with the screw rod 5 and the positioning rod 6, the scraped oil stains attached to the bottom of the oil removal plate 10 can be scraped again through the scraping plate 23, and the scraped oil stains can fall into the second collecting box 21 to be collected.
